
CSP-J初赛集训
文章平均质量分 86
CSP-J初赛集训
优惠券已抵扣
余额抵扣
还需支付
¥399.90
¥499.90
购买须知?
本专栏为图文内容,最终完结不会低于15篇文章。
订阅专栏,享有专栏所有文章阅读权限。
本专栏为虚拟商品,基于网络商品和虚拟商品的性质和特征,专栏一经购买无正当理由不予退款,不支持升级,敬请谅解。
天秀信奥编程培训
信息学奥赛老师
展开
-
CSP-J选择题专项训练1 - C++语言特性
CSP-J选择题专项训练1 - C++语言特性第一套第 1 题 以下C++不可以作为变量的名称的是( )。A. CCF GESPB. ccfGESPC. CCFgespD. CCF_GESP第 2 题 C++中用于动态内存分配的关键字是( )。A. mallocB. allocateC. newD. create第 3 题 C++中,下面哪个选项是合法的数组声明( )。A. int arr[10];B. int arr[];C. int arr[10.5];原创 2024-08-06 11:50:37 · 142 阅读 · 0 评论 -
第一章 - 第11节- 因特网概述 - 课后习题
用户名和域名都不能为空;万维网(World Wide Web,简称WWW或Web)是一个基于超文本和HTTP协议的、全球性的、动态交互的、跨平台的分布式图形信息系统。它是建立在互联网基础上的一种网络服务,向世界提供了一个互相关连的、可以通过浏览器访问的大量超文本文档,极大地方便了信息的发布、检索和获取。TCP/IP协议是互联网的核心协议,它是一个多层次的协议集合,将复杂的网络通信过程分解为若干个相对独立的层次,每个层次负责不同的通信功能。在电子邮件的工作过程中,发送邮件和接收邮件是由不同的协议分工完成的。原创 2024-06-20 15:06:26 · 164 阅读 · 0 评论 -
第一章 - 第11节- 因特网概述 - 课件
因特网(Internet)是一个建立在网络互联基础上的最大的、开放的全球性网络。因特网拥有数千万台计算机和上亿个用户,是全球信息资源的超大型集合体。因特网起源于 20 世纪 60 年代中期,由美国国防部高级研究计划局(ARPA)资助的 ARPANET,此后提出的 TCP/IP 协议为因特网的发展奠定了基础。我国正式接入因特网是在 1994 年 4 月,当时为了发展国际科研合作的需要,中国科学院高能物理研究所和北京化工大学开通了到美国的因特网专线,并有千余科技界人士使用了因特网。原创 2024-06-20 10:03:46 · 206 阅读 · 0 评论 -
第二章 - 第2节- 栈 - 课后习题
要想按照1,2,3,4,5的顺序出栈,就需要先将所有元素出栈,然后再按照相反的顺序重新入栈,这样才能实现先进先出的顺序,但这已经违背了栈的基本特性。因此,函数调用是栈的重要应用。这也体现了栈的后进先出特性,因为不同的出栈顺序会导致不同的出栈序列,而这些出栈序列的数量与元素的排列方式直接相关。虽然4和5不是按照入栈的相反顺序出栈的,但是它们可以先出栈,然后再按照后进先出的顺序出栈剩余的元素。在分析出栈序列时,我们需要按照与入栈顺序相反的顺序进行出栈,即最后入栈的元素最先出栈,最先入栈的元素最后出栈。原创 2024-06-18 18:36:11 · 128 阅读 · 0 评论 -
第二章 - 第2节- 栈 - 课件
将A柱上的部分盘子经由B柱移入C柱,若A柱上的操作记录为:进,进,进,进,出,出,进,出,进,出,进,出,那么在A柱上从下到上依次留下的编号为( )第四题 【NOIP2003提高组】已知元素{8,25,14,87,51,90,6,19,20},则这些元素以( )的顺序依次被推入栈后,使栈的顺序满足:在51前有90;入栈顺序为:25,51,8,20,19,90,87,14,6,最终栈中的顺序(从栈顶到栈底)为:6,14,87,90,51,19,20,8,25,满足题目给出的所有条件。原创 2024-06-18 16:28:12 · 120 阅读 · 0 评论 -
第二章 - 第1节- 逻辑运算 -课后习题
第一题 若 P = true,Q = false,R = true,则逻辑表达式 (P ∧ Q) ∨ (¬P ∧ R) 的值为:正确答案:B解析:正确答案:B解析:正确答案:D解析:首先,我们需要了解各个运算符的优先级和计算顺序。在 C++ 中,按位与(&)的优先级高于按位或(|),按位异或()的优先级在两者之间。因此,我们先计算按位与(&)和按位异或(),然后计算按位或(|)。计算 15 & 6:计算 12 ^ 3:计算 (15 & 6) | (12 ^ 3):因此,表达式 15 & 6 | 12 ^原创 2024-06-17 18:43:03 · 225 阅读 · 0 评论 -
第二章 - 第1节- 逻辑运算 - 课件
第六题 设全集I = {a, b, c, d, e, f, g, h},集合B ∪ A = {a, b, c, d, e, f},C ∩ A = {c, d, e},~B ∩ A = {a, d},那么集合 (C ∩ B ∩ A) 为( )第四题 设全集I = {a, b, c, d, e, f, g},集合A = {a, b, c},B = {b, d, e},C = {e, f, g},那么集合 (A - B) ∪ (¬C ∩ B) 为( )=0) && (c )!=0),选项 B 正确。原创 2024-06-17 17:41:24 · 475 阅读 · 0 评论 -
第一章 - 第10节- 计算机网络 - 课后习题
综上所述,在给出的四个IP地址中,只有193.168.0.300是错误的,因为它的第四组数超过了255,违反了IP地址的表示规则。综上所述,在TCP/IP网络中,用于标识Internet上节点的是IP地址,它是每个节点在Internet上的唯一标识,只有正确配置了IP地址,节点才能接入Internet,进行网络通信,故选项B正确。综上所述,在总线型网络中,作为公共传输介质的总线其地位至关重要,一旦发生故障,其影响将是灾难性的,整个网络都将瘫痪,因此总线故障对系统的影响是毁灭性的,故选项C正确。原创 2024-06-14 15:57:25 · 164 阅读 · 0 评论 -
第一章 - 第10节- 计算机网络 - 课件
所谓计算机网络,就是利用通信线路和设备,把分布在不同地理位置上的多台计算机连接起来。计算机网络是现代通信技术与计算机技术相结合的产物。网络中计算机与计算机之间的通信依靠协议进行。协议是计算机收、发数据的规则。TCP/IP:用于网络的一组通信协议。包括IP(Internet Protocol)和TCP(Transmission Control Protocol)。原创 2024-06-14 15:25:24 · 169 阅读 · 0 评论 -
第一章 - 第9节- 原码补码反码 - 课后习题
正确答案: A正确答案: A正确答案: B正确答案: B正确答案: A正确答案: A正确答案: A正确答案: B正确答案: A正确答案: B正确答案: C正确答案: C正确答案: B正确答案: A正确答案: D正确答案: B正确答案: A正确答案: B正确答案: B正确答案: B。原创 2024-06-14 14:16:54 · 361 阅读 · 0 评论 -
第一章 - 第9节- 原码补码反码 - 课件
在学习原码、反码和补码之前,需要先了解机器数和真值的概念。原创 2024-06-12 20:55:49 · 178 阅读 · 0 评论 -
第一章 - 第8节- 计算机安全知识 - 课后习题
正确答案:A正确答案:D正确答案:A正确答案:A正确答案:A正确答案:D正确答案:B正确答案:C正确答案:A正确答案:C正确答案:A正确答案:D正确答案:A正确答案:D正确答案:A正确答案:D正确答案:C正确答案:C正确答案:C正确答案:C。原创 2024-06-12 15:15:59 · 81 阅读 · 0 评论 -
第一章 - 第8节- 计算机安全知识 - 课件
计算机安全主要包括硬件安全、存储安全和计算机病毒三个方面的内容。原创 2024-06-12 11:22:18 · 225 阅读 · 0 评论 -
第一章 - 第7节- 信息编码表示 - 课后习题
课后习题ASCII码的全称是什么?A. American Standard Code for Information InterchangeB. American Standard Code for Internet InteractionC. American Special Code for Information InterchangeD. American Special Code for Internet InteractionASCII码最初规定了多少个字符的编码?A.原创 2024-06-12 10:11:03 · 103 阅读 · 0 评论 -
第一章 - 第7节- 信息编码表示 - 课件
在计算机内部是通过二进制编码的方式表示信息,故在存储信息之前需要先转换成计算机能够识别的编码。原创 2024-06-11 20:51:57 · 236 阅读 · 0 评论 -
第一章 - 第6节- 数制转换 - 课后习题
不足四位的,在左边补0。将二进制数1100001.111转换成十六进制数的方法是:将二进制数从小数点开始,向左和向右每四位一组分成多组,不足四位的补0,然后将每一组转换成对应的十六进制数即可。二进制数10110.0011转换为八进制数的方法是:将二进制数从小数点开始,向左和向右每三位一组分成多组,不足三位的补0,然后将每一组转换成对应的八进制数即可。在将八进制数32.416转换为二进制数的过程中,整数部分"32"₈转换为二进制数的方法是:将每1位八进制数转换成3位二进制数。原创 2024-06-11 17:12:55 · 91 阅读 · 0 评论 -
第一章 - 第6节- 数制转换 - 课件
将数字符号按序排列成数位,并遵照某种由低位到高位的进位方式计数表示数值的方法,称作进位计数制。原创 2024-06-11 16:52:30 · 132 阅读 · 0 评论 -
第一章 - 第5节- 计算机语言 - 课后习题
第 1 题 计算机语言分为哪两大类?A. 高级语言和低级语言B. 编译型语言和解释型语言C. 面向过程语言和面向对象语言D. 机器语言和汇编语言第 2 题 低级语言的特点是什么?A. 可读性和可移植性差B. 依赖于硬件C. 执行效率高D. 以上都对第 3 题 机器语言使用什么代码表示指令?A. 汇编代码B. 二进制代码C. 十进制代码D. 十六进制代码第 4 题 汇编语言使用什么来代替特定指令?A. 数字B. 字母和单词C. 符号。原创 2024-06-10 20:37:36 · 132 阅读 · 0 评论 -
第一章 - 第5节- 计算机语言 - 课件
计算机语言分为和。原创 2024-06-10 19:14:04 · 308 阅读 · 0 评论 -
第一章 - 第4节-计算机软件系统 - 课后习题
没有安装软件的计算机被称为:A. 裸机B. 死机C. 空机D. 废机软件和硬件之间的关系是:A. 相互独立B. 相互关联,可以相互转化,互为补充C. 软件依赖硬件,但硬件不依赖软件D. 硬件依赖软件,但软件不依赖硬件计算机软件系统按其功能可分为:A. 系统软件和辅助软件B. 系统软件和应用软件C. 应用软件和辅助软件D. 系统软件、应用软件和辅助软件最重要的系统软件是:A. 数据库管理系统B. 操作系统C. 程序设计语言的编译系统。原创 2024-06-10 17:48:55 · 471 阅读 · 1 评论 -
第一章 - 第4节-计算机软件系统 - 课件
DBMS 是在操作系统支持下运行的,借助于操作系统实现对数据的存储和管理,使数据能被各种不同的用户所共享,保证用户得到的数据是完整的,可靠的。综上所述,MySQL、SQL Server、Oracle和Visual FoxPro都是数据库软件,而金山影霸是多媒体播放软件,不是数据库软件。综上所述,Windows XP、DOS、Linux和OS/2都是操作系统软件,而Arch/Info是一个地理信息系统软件,不是操作系统软件。这是计算机软件系统的基本分类方式,是计算机基础知识的重要组成部分。原创 2024-06-10 16:57:39 · 804 阅读 · 1 评论 -
第一章 - 第3节- 中央处理器CPU - 课后习题
综上所述,CPU的性能指标是一个多方面、多层次的综合体现,包括基本参数、微架构、物理实现等多个方面。要准确评估一款CPU的性能,需要全面考虑主频、字长、缓存、指令集、处理技术、制造工艺等各项指标,不能顾此失彼。SRAM具有极高的读写速度,能够跟上CPU的节奏,是高速缓存的理想选择。高速缓存是位于CPU和主存之间的一种高速小容量存储器,用于缓冲频繁访问的指令和数据,以弥补CPU和主存之间的速度差异。主频是CPU性能的核心指标,表示CPU内部时钟振荡的频率,直接决定了CPU的运算速度。C. 并行指令流水结构。原创 2024-06-09 17:48:08 · 204 阅读 · 0 评论 -
第一章 - 第3节- 中央处理器CPU - 课件
某一特定程序P分别编译为处理器A和处理器B的指令,编译结果处理器A的指令数是处理器B的4倍。已知程序P的算法时间复杂度为O(n^2),如果处理器A执行程序P时能在一小时内完成的输入规模为n,则处理器B执行程序P时能在一小时内完成的输入规模为( )。CPU(Central Processing Unit),即中央处理器,是计算机的核心部件,负责执行各种指令,完成算术运算、逻辑运算、数据传输等任务。4.【NOIP2001】若我们说一个微机的CPU是用的PII300,此处的300确切指的是( )原创 2024-06-09 17:13:19 · 208 阅读 · 0 评论 -
第一章 - 第2节- 计算机系统的基础结构 - 课后习题
正确答案:A正确答案:A正确答案:D正确答案:D正确答案:D正确答案:C正确答案:A正确答案:B正确答案:A正确答案:B正确答案:C正确答案:A正确答案:C正确答案:A正确答案:C正确答案:B正确答案:A正确答案:C正确答案:C正确答案:C。原创 2024-06-09 16:31:51 · 414 阅读 · 0 评论 -
第一章 - 第2节- 计算机系统的基础结构 - 课件
计算机系统由硬件和软件两部分组成。硬件系统是计算机的“躯干”,是物质基础。而软件系统则是建立在这个“躯干”上的“灵魂”,没有安装任何软件的计算机称为裸机。从宏观角度来看,计算机最底层的基础是各种硬件设备,然后在裸机上安装操作系统,之后再在操作系统下安装各种应用软件,最后用户只需使用各种应用软件即可。从微观角度来看,计算机组成及各部分的功能如下图所示。值得注意的是外部设备与主机之间、主机中的各个部件之间的存储速度不一样,存储速度由慢到快依次是外存、内存、Cache、CPU。可见CPU的存储速度是最快的。原创 2024-06-09 15:18:21 · 250 阅读 · 0 评论 -
第一章 - 第1节-计算机概述 - 课后习题
冯·诺依曼奠定了现代计算机的体系结构,香农开创了信息论,莫尔推动了集成电路的进步,他们都是计算机和电子技术领域的奠基人或先驱,但都不是人工智能研究的开拓者。模拟计算机与数字计算机一样,都是按照计算机的工作原理来划分的两大类型,反映的是计算机内部数据表示和处理方式的区别。而专业计算机和通用计算机则是按照计算机的应用领域来划分的,反映的是计算机功能和性能的针对性差异。晶体管、集成电路、大规模集成电路分别标志着第二、三、四代计算机的核心元件,反映了电子计算机发展的三个重要阶段,但都不是第一代计算机的特征。原创 2024-06-08 17:05:57 · 295 阅读 · 0 评论 -
第一章 - 第1节-计算机概述 - 课件
(1)冯·诺依曼:被称为“计算机之父”,提出计算机体系结构;(2)图灵:被称为“人工智能之父”,提出了一种判定机器是否具有智能的试验方法,即图灵试验。此外,图灵提出的著名的图灵机模型为现代计算机的逻辑工作方式奠定了基础。冯·诺依曼提出计算机硬件设备由存储器、运算器、控制器、输入设备和输出设备五部分组成(如下图所示),并且由总线连接。总线包括地址总线、数据总线、控制总线。原创 2024-06-08 16:40:16 · 605 阅读 · 0 评论 -
第二章 - 第3节 - 树 - 课件
数据结构知识点 - 树树的基本概念1.1 树的定义和术语1 . 树是一种非线性的数据结构,由节点(node)和连接节点的边(edge)组成。2 . 节点可以存储数据,边表示节点之间的关系。3 . 根节点(root)是树的起始节点,一棵树只有一个根节点,它没有父节点。4 . 除根节点外,每个节点都有唯一的父节点。5 . 节点可以有零个或多个子节点,有子节点的节点称为内部节点或分支节点,没有子节点的节点称为叶子节点或终端节点。6 . 一个节点和它的所有后代节点(包括子节点、孙节点等)构成该节点原创 2024-05-17 03:15:59 · 794 阅读 · 0 评论